2 0 1 7 E S S E N T I A L S : PA I D S U P P L I E R PA C K A G E

To increase awareness for the Essentials Collection, Vintages is offering a new paid supplier opportunity that includes external media and an in-store display. • Opportunity is available starting in P12 • For two brands • Participating products must be on BAM or LTO offer • Brands will be featured together in promotional material and merchandised

together on display.

• Cost: $20,000 ($10,000 / supplier)

OVERVIEW

METRO NEWS Half page ad in Toronto on the 1st Thursday of the period Half page ad in Ottawa on the 1st Thursday of the period Reach: Metro Toronto: Circ. 198,198 / Readership 650,000 Metro Ottawa: Circ. 45,639 / Readership 124,000

PRINT ADVERTISING

FACEBOOK LINK ADS Utilize hyper targeted paid social media to engage target with Essentials message and drive traffic to lcbo.com for purchase.

Timing: 4 weeks Estimated Total Impressions: 2.9 million Targets: Paid posts will target people who are already more likely to be interested in wine. Niche targets - Wine, Winemaking, wine and food matching, wine tasting. Digital ads will link to PIP page on lcbo.com via “buy now” CTA.

PAID SOCIAL MEDIA

IN-STORE DISPLAY

“CUSTOMER FAVOURITES” 2 skus on front facing end aisle

30 – 50 stores (Toronto & Ottawa)

P12 start

Signage: backer card and shelf talkers

Updated Essentials Package

VINTAGES NET SALES SKU TARGET - ESSENTIALS

Based on Subset’s performance when composed by 4 SKUs or more.

Based on Set’s performance if

less than 4 SKUs

SKUs cumulative share of the Subset / Set in order to protect 90% of net sales.

Updated Essentials Package

VINTAGES NET SALES SKU TARGET - ESSENTIALS

Minimum net sales SKU target: $450K. Maximum net sales SKU target: $1.5M. In the example below the new target is $1,200,000:

Set Set Subset Essential Desc.

Net Sales Rolling 13 TY Share

Cum. Share

ITALY RED TUSCANY OTHER Essential 1 5,000,000$ 52% 52%ITALY RED TUSCANY OTHER Essential 2 2,500,000$ 26% 77%ITALY RED TUSCANY OTHER Essential 3 1,200,000$ 12% 90%ITALY RED TUSCANY OTHER Essential 4 1,000,000$ 10% 100%

WINES OF THE MONTH

Colby Norrington, Vintages Category Manager, New World Wines

WINES OF THE MONTH Wines of the Month

Eliminating the Benchmark Program as of P9

Expanding the WOM to a bi-weekly program

Additional spots will focus on products only over $22.95

The products will:

‒ Have a wide customer appeal

‒ Over deliver for the price

‒ Provide a trade up opportunity

HOW IT FITS IN Wines of the Month

Implementation is effective for the last release of P9

The $17 solution is an approachable price point focus program

WOM are wines with broad appeal $19.95 – $22.95

AIS are wines suited to gifting

VINTAGES LICENSEE PROGRAM Licensee Programs

Services to Licensees Pre-order from upcoming releases Licensee tasting opportunities Product Consultation and advice Focus on education and customer service How you can work with us Partner on product tastings

Proposal to Julie Hauser 6 months in advance Refer customers who would like to pre-order Contact Julie Hauser to discuss ways we can work together to sell VINTAGES products E: julie.hauser@lcbo.com

LICENSEE ONLY PORTFOLIO Licensee Programs

LCBO collaborates with suppliers to develop and promote the Licensee Only Portfolio Requirements to Participate Sales Target: Minimum $80,000 net per year Requirements: Provide proven sales history and

upfront commitments from on premise customers Expectations: Sales driven by agents Sales Tools Portfolio available on new licensee portal Existing skus can participate in LTO’s
